Stelios started in Electronics and specifically Circuit Board Manufacturing in 1984, operating specialized processes such as those used in multi-wire technology. Though his original education was in Physics, he found engineering and electronics more rewarding. After 10 years in various manufacturing, laboratory, and environmental positions, he landed at SAE Circuits Colorado, Inc. in Boulder, CO, and has been with them since 1994. Originally the facility's Environmental, Laboratory, & Health and Safety Manager, he transferred to the position of Process Engineering Manager in 2006. As Environmental Manager, he earned several awards for SAE Circuits, with a specialization in waste minimization, including water usage and chemical usage efficiencies and reductions in manufacturing processes. Research in ion exchange and ligands technology is one of his specialties. Certified as an ISO internal auditor in 2001, he helped devise and implement ISO-9002 when it first hit the electronics industry. As process engineering manager for SAE Circuits, his directive is technological innovation and implementation. Stelios' additional interests include human biochemistry and nutrition, the study of complex environmental processes, and all types of multidisciplinary scientific research including archaeology and astronomy.Pre-Process Engineer & Consultant @ Duties: Interfacing with customers in order to meet specific design needs.
